Redskins to Choose Clausen?

At least we know one thing, the Washington Redskins will not trade out of the first round.

The Redskins announced the team's first-round pick will join new head coach Mike Shanahan at the annual draft day party at FedEx Field. This year, the first round of the draft is on a Thursday.

Who the Redskins take with the No. 4 pick won't be known for another month, but in the latest mock draft on NFL.com, Pat Kirwan has the Skins choosing Notre Dame quarterback Jimmy Clausen. He's not alone.

Draft guru Mel Kiper Jr. also has Clausen wearing the burgundy and gold. Kiper is real high on Clausen, who played in a pro-style offense at Notre Dame under coach Charlie Weiss.

For those fans hoping the Skins go after Sam Bradford, it appears the St. Louis Rams are leaning towards taking him with the first pick overall.

The drama over who the Redskins will and should take will last another month. Most die hard fans want new general manager Bruce Allen and Shanahan to build up the offensive lineman. That's the position Kirwan originally had the Skins targeting, but things have changed. 

Don't get too invested in these mock drafts, the only thing for certain is that things will continue to change.
